Kindergarten-Grade 5

Reading aloud to your student, whether it's a classic novel or a bedtime fairy tale, provides several benefits, such as:

  • Boosted cognitive development.
  • Better language skills.
  • Stronger bonding with your child.
  • Improved focus and self-discipline.
  • Increased creativity and imagination.
  • Encouragement of a lifelong love of reading.

Middle School

  • Talk to your student about their interests and explore college majors and career options together.
  • Help them build good study habits.
  • Stay on top of their grades and maintain a strong connection with teachers and counselors—seek tutoring if needed.
  • Keep planning financially for your student's future.
